The Take Away
If you’re a bride-to-be, here’s my advice: Do things the way you want, your way. Don’t worry about what you see on Instagram. Don’t try to do the “trending” bridal festivities if you don’t want to. There’s so many people doing things for likes and tags that’s it’s more refreshing these days to see something different. If you’re on a budget, there are still ways to get cute Instagram pictures that you will get organic likes for. The thing about being on a budget is that it pushes you to be creative. The best things come from creativity.
